5.0 out of 5 stars A-Ha is MUCH more than an 80's, January 6, 2003
This review is from: Forever Not Yours (Audio CD)
Many Americans will be very pleasantly suprised and amazed at what A-ha is doing these days. These guys are HUGE all over the world except for the US. I have no idea why this country is so sadly deprived of this truly SPECTACULAR music. Songs off of their Lifelines (2002) album include stunning epic-style songs rich with pop-orchestral beauty, others are rather funky, techno-pop style, while others have a more "unplugged sound. My suggestion would be to get the entire Lifelines album AND their 2000 album "Minor Earth Major Sky" and feast on those two to begin with, as these 2 albums are a-ha's best work. You will love them. Their earlier albums lack only in producing and engineering, but a-ha's talent is just as evident even then. To see a couple videos, go to a-ha dotcom. You'll see the videos for "Forever Not Yours" and the beautifully haunting "Lifelines". Make sure to click onto the flash video link as well to see a flash video for "I Wish I Cared" off their "Minor Earth.." album. This song alone must be heard on a great stereo system to be fully appreciated. YOU WILL LOVE A-HA!!! They're now my favorite group and I can't get enough. 4.0 out of 5 stars they're baaaack!, April 9, 2002
This review is from: Forever Not Yours (Audio CD)
I only found out this past winter that a-ha had made a comeback in 2000. Even though the news was a little late, I was so happy to discover that one of my favorite bands from the 80s is back!! After falling in love with them all over again listening to their 2000 Minor Earth Major Sky album, I'm happy to say they've done it again. Their latest release is a catchy, symphonic melody. Morten Harket's falsettos are still as strong and clear as ever. Backed by a calming piano and strings, it's easy for this song to get stuck in your head all day - and that's a good thing! Because this was produced by Stephen Hague, best known for his work with New Order and the Pet Shop Boys, you can hear his trademark poppy beat in the background. I hope this gets its much-deserved airplay in the US! It's really a sweet, catchy song... worth a listen for any a-ha fan... and may even turn you into one!
